Kilohertz droplet-on-demand serial femtosecond crystallography at the European XFEL station FXE

Samuel Perrett,
Alisia Fadini,
Christopher D. M. Hutchison
et al.

Abstract: X-ray Free Electron Lasers (XFELs) allow the collection of high-quality serial femtosecond crystallography data. The next generation of megahertz superconducting FELs promises to drastically reduce data collection times, enabling the capture of more structures with higher signal-to-noise ratios and facilitating more complex experiments.
